2017-04-23 14 views
0

次のコードを手動で.mpdファイルに追加しようとしています。MPEG DASH mpdファイルにaac単一オーディオを追加

<AdaptationSet contentType="audio" segmentAlignment="true" bitstreamSwitching="true" lang="English"> 
     <Representation id="1" mimeType="audio/mp4" codecs="mp4a.40.2" audioSamplingRate="44100"> 
      <AudioChannelConfiguration schemeIdUri="urn:mpeg:dash:23003:3:audio_channel_configuration:2011" value="2" /> 
      <SegmentTemplate timescale="44100" media="http://localhost/audio.aac" startNumber="1"> 
      </SegmentTemplate> 
     </Representation> 
    </AdaptationSet> 

しかし、それは機能しません。すべてが.mpdファイルでセグメント化されなければなりませんか?または単一の.accファイルを持つことはできますか?

答えて

1

これは動作しません!まずメディアをMPEG-DASHに準拠した形式にパッケージ化する必要があります。だから、セグメント化する必要があります。 "audio/mp4" MIMEタイプの場合は、メディアをMP4コンテナに追加する必要があります。

そのためには、MP4Boxのようなオープンソースツールを使用できます。

関連する問題